PennWest University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2022-2023 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at PennWest University paid an average of $482 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$322 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$7,716 $11,574
Fees $3,672 $4,432
Books and Supplies $1,240 $1,240
On Campus Room and Board $13,200 $13,200
On Campus Other Expenses $3,480 $3,480

PennWest University Political Science & Government Bachelor’s Program Diversity

Of the 23 political science students who graduated with a bachelor's degree in 2021-2022 from PennWest University, about 43% were men and 57% were women.

The majority of bachelor's degree recipients in this major at PennWest University are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 91% of students fell into this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Pennsylvania Western University with a bachelor's in political science.

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 0
Black or African American 1
Hispanic or Latino 1
White 21
Non-Resident Aliens 0
Other Races 0
